Colorado Springs Airport (also known as Peterson Air Force Base) is located near Colorado Springs, Colorado, and ranks among the busiest in the state. The airport hosts mostly regional airlines, which operate to destinations across the mid-western US.

Frontier encouraged by its strategy of dodging Southwest in Denver, but looks for new bases
Frontier Airlines believes its tactic to target markets from its main Denver base not served by rival Southwest Airlines remains the best method in fortifying its major hub. But at the same time Frontier is looking to lessen its reliance on a single hub and is exploring new bases, two of which are opening this summer supported by a single aircraft.
Southwest returned to the Denver market dominated by United and Frontier in 2006, and since that time has built its presence at the airport to 159 daily departures to 51 destinations. Based on US Department of Transportation (DoT) data, Southwest had a 22.5% market share at the airport from Feb-2011 to Jan-2012.
